COMING SOON...Ground Source Heat Pumps

Duration: 3 days

 

 

Introduction:

This course is for those wishing to install air/ground source heat pumps
 

Course objectives/key benefits:

For those with all the identified pre-requisite qualifications listed registration onto the micro-generation scheme can be sought.
 

Who the course is aimed at:

The course is intended for experienced plumbers; heating engineers or gas/oil installers who wish to be able to satisfy the requirements of the building Regulations in relation to this renewable technology.
 

Course content:

  • Understanding heat pump technology
  • Design and installation
  • Feed in tariffs
  • Maintenance of GSHP systems

Course tutor:

Simon Butcher/Roy Treloar
 

Training method:

Powerpoint presentations and hands on practical demonstrations
 

Course outcomes:

BPEC Certificate in Installation/Maintenance of Ground Source Heat Pumps
 

Pre-requisite knowledge/qualifications:

Appropriate NVQ or similar in Plumbing/Heating or a gas/oil certificate; Water Regulation qualification; Unvented dhw qualification.
 

Recommended follow-up courses:

Certification through one of the micro-generation scheme providers
